Thrust Ball Bearing Definition. Thrust bearings fall into three main categories of thrust ball bearings, needle thrust. They are composed of one or more spherical balls positioned within the bearing. A thrust bearing is a type of bearing designed to carry the axial load and reduce friction between the moving parts. Axial loads are forces that act parallel to the axis of rotation,. Thrust ball bearings are bearings that use spherical balls as rolling elements. Thrust ball bearings are a type of rolling element bearing that is designed to handle axial loads. What is thrust ball bearing? A thrust bearing is a rotary bearing designed mainly to accommodate axial loads.
